U.S. Flew to the Top in Wind Power Production Last Year
The U.S. surpassed Germany as the biggest producer of wind power in 2008, I guess proving that its alternative energy efforts haven't just been a load of hot air. More » -

Low-Power Radio Tech Could Eliminate Remote Control Battery Waste
There's tech in the works by the folks at Green Peak that could turn your battery-eating remote control into an energy-efficient device worthy of a true "green" environmental label. Couch potatoes rejoice! More » -

Pentagon Goes Green With 4,000 LED Installation
Apparently, even the tough-as-nails Pentagon, home of the Department of Defense, has a soft spot for green technology, as word comes to us today that 4,000 LED fixtures will illuminate the building's Wedge 5. More » -

Ecobee Smart Thermostat Can Adjust Home Temps Online
Winter is just around the corner and, with gas prices still unstable, it's now even more important to monitor your thermostat. That's tough and annoying though, which is why gadgets like Ecobee are coming out on the market. Ecobee has an integrated programmable smart thermostat with a WiFi-enabled touchscreen that automatically sets your household to conserve energy at the press of a button. More » -
